Signs of Disease in Trees
Trees can exhibit various signs of disease that are vital for identification and assessment. Discoloration of leaves, such as yellowing or browning, often indicates stress or disease. Abnormal growths, like galls or cankers, signal potential infections. Moreover, leaf drop outside of the normal seasonal cycle can suggest underlying issues. Fungal growth, including mushrooms at the base or on limbs, often points to decay and weakened structural integrity.
In addition, premature leaf loss or stunted growth may signify nutrient deficiencies or root problems. An unusual number of insect infestations can also be symptomatic of a compromised tree. Regular monitoring for these signs is essential for timely intervention and management, helping to maintain tree health and stability.

Structural Issues and Weaknesses
After evaluating for signs of disease, it’s important to assess the structural integrity of the tree. Structural issues, such as extensive trunk decay, can compromise the tree’s stability. Inspect for cracks or splits in the trunk and large branches; these may indicate weakness. A tree with a significant lean or an uneven canopy often signals underlying structural problems that could lead to failure.
Additionally, check for dead or brittle limbs, which are more prone to breaking. Root damage, including exposed roots or soil erosion around the base, can also weaken the tree. If these structural weaknesses are substantial, the risk of falling increases, necessitating tree removal to guarantee safety.
Large trees with visible cavities, hollow trunks, or compromised root systems are especially concerning in high-wind zones. In areas like Montgomery County, routine inspections by licensed tree risk assessors are often recommended to prevent collapse and liability.
Proximity to Structures and Power Lines
When trees grow too close to structures or power lines, they pose significant risks that warrant careful consideration. Over time, branches may encroach on rooftops, gutters, or windows, leading to potential property damage. Additionally, falling limbs can cause severe injury or even fatalities.
Trees near power lines can create electrical hazards, especially during storms or high winds, increasing the risk of outages or fires. Utility companies often require a specific clearance distance, and failure to maintain this can result in penalties or forced tree removal.
Regular inspections are essential; if a tree’s growth frequently necessitates trimming, it might be more prudent to remove it entirely. Proximity to structures and power lines should always be a factor in tree management decisions. Working near energized lines should never be attempted by untrained individuals. Certified utility arborists use insulated tools and aerial lifts to meet OSHA standards while performing hazardous removals near electrical infrastructure.
Signs of Pest Infestation
How can one identify signs of pest infestation in a tree? First, look for visible damage, such as holes in the bark or wood, which often indicate insect activity. Additionally, the presence of frass small, sawdust-like droppings can signal wood-boring pests. Leaves may exhibit unusual discoloration, wilting, or premature dropping, suggesting that pests are feeding on the foliage.
Inspect the tree for webbing or nests, which may be indicative of spider mites or caterpillars. Moreover, a significant increase in ants around the base may point to an underlying pest issue, particularly with aphids or scale insects. Regular monitoring can help detect these signs early, allowing for appropriate intervention before severe damage occurs.
Emerald ash borer, gypsy moths, and ambrosia beetles are among the invasive pests affecting Maryland’s trees. Integrated Pest Management (IPM) strategies or complete tree removal may be necessary depending on infestation severity.
Changes in Growth Patterns
What signs of change in growth patterns should one look for to determine if a tree may need removal? Uneven growth, where one side of the tree shows considerably more development than the other, often indicates structural issues. Additionally, stunted growth or dieback in branches signifies potential health problems.
Trees that produce fewer leaves or exhibit smaller foliage than usual may be struggling to thrive. If a tree suddenly experiences excessive growth after a period of dormancy, this could signal underlying stress or disease. Finally, observe for changes in bark texture or color, which can indicate decay. Any of these changes warrant a closer inspection, as they may suggest the tree’s integrity is compromised and removal should be considered.
Environmental Factors Affecting Tree Health
Although trees are resilient organisms, their health can be greatly impacted by various environmental factors. Soil quality plays a significant role; nutrient deficiency or contamination can stunt growth and lead to disease. Additionally, water availability is critical; both drought and excessive moisture can cause stress, resulting in root rot or wilting.
Temperature fluctuations, especially extreme weather events, can also weaken trees, making them susceptible to pests and diseases. Pollution, including air and soil contaminants, further exacerbates these issues, damaging foliage and disrupting photosynthesis. Finally, competition with nearby plants for sunlight and resources can hinder a tree’s overall vitality.
Monitoring these environmental factors is essential for evaluating tree health and determining if tree removal might be necessary to prevent further risks. In urban environments like Rockville or Bethesda, compacted soil, stormwater runoff, and heat island effects further complicate tree survival. Arborists may conduct soil testing and canopy assessments before recommending removal.

Can a Tree Recover from Significant Damage?
A tree can recover from significant damage if its essential structures, like the cambium, remain intact. Proper care, including pruning and watering, aids recovery, but severe damage may hinder regrowth and overall health.

Do I Need a Permit to Remove a Tree?
To determine if a permit’s needed for tree removal, one should check local regulations. Many municipalities require permits, especially for larger trees or specific species. It’s crucial to contact local authorities before proceeding with removal.
What Should I Do with the Stump After Removal?
After removal, one can grind the stump down, leaving mulch, or opt for chemical treatments to accelerate decay. Alternatively, they might choose to create a decorative feature or plant around it, enhancing the landscape’s aesthetics.
